温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

MyBatis如何助力Spring实现数据恢复

发布时间:2024-10-28 12:00:17 来源:亿速云 阅读:78 作者:小樊 栏目:编程语言

MyBatis本身并不直接涉及数据恢复的功能,但它在Spring中可以与数据恢复相关操作进行配合。数据恢复通常涉及到数据库的操作,MyBatis作为数据访问层框架,可以与Spring的事务管理、备份恢复等功能结合,间接支持数据恢复的操作。以下是MyBatis与Spring集成时,如何支持数据恢复的相关信息:

MyBatis与Spring集成概述

  • 依赖添加:在Spring Boot项目中,需要添加MyBatis和数据库驱动的依赖。
  • 配置数据源:在application.propertiesapplication.yml文件中配置数据库连接信息。
  • 创建实体类和Mapper接口:根据数据库表结构创建对应的Java实体类和Mapper接口。
  • 配置Mapper扫描:在Spring配置类中使用@MapperScan注解指定Mapper接口的包路径。

数据恢复操作

  • 备份数据库:在进行数据恢复之前,首先需要备份数据库。这可以通过导出数据库表结构和数据来完成。
  • 恢复数据库:使用备份文件,可以通过MyBatis的SqlSession对象执行SQL脚本,将数据库恢复到备份时的状态。

MyBatis在数据恢复中的角色

  • 执行SQL脚本:MyBatis可以执行SQL脚本,这对于恢复操作至关重要。通过SqlSession,可以执行备份文件中的SQL脚本,将数据库恢复到指定时间点。
  • 事务管理:MyBatis可以与Spring的事务管理集成,确保数据恢复操作的原子性和一致性。

MyBatis通过其灵活的数据访问能力和与Spring的紧密集成,为数据恢复操作提供了支持。然而,实际的数据恢复操作通常涉及到更复杂的逻辑,需要根据具体需求进行详细设计和实现。

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

AI